Man booked in Patiala for creating woman’s fake Facebook account
The police have booked a 21-year-old man for harassing a girl by using her photographs to create a fake Facebook profile of hers. He is also accused of stalking her. The accused was identified as Mohit Kumar and is on the run.

“My daughter started getting calls from multiple mobile numbers as the accused also posted her number on the fake id and when somebody told her about the source of getting her number, she alarmed the family,” said, mother of the 20-year-old girl, in her complaint.
The police said that the complainant runs a boutique in front of the house of the accused. The mother of the accused had obtained victims’ mobile number for medical emergency as she worked at a hospital.
However, the accused somehow obtained the number and used her WhatsApp profile pictures to create the profile on the social networking website.
The police have registered a case under Section 66-D of Information Technology (IT) Act, 2000 (cheating by personation by using computer resource) and 354 D (stalking) of Indian Penal Code (IPC) at Kotwali Patiala police station. No arrest has been made so far.
The police said the investigation was on and efforts were on to nab him.
